Both long- and short-term gains are subject to the income tax rates listed above, with a top rate of 5.70% for 2021. Kansas Sales Tax. The state sales tax rate in Kansas is 6.5%. In many areas, however, the actual rate paid on purchases is higher than that, thanks to county and local rates.

Kansas' 2012 tax package made three major changes: a Cut personal income tax rates. This page: • Lists basic Kansas state tax ...The credit is 50 percent of the contribution (s) made during the taxable year. If the approved community service organization is located in a rural community (population of 15,000 or less), the credit is 70 percent of the contribution (s) made during the taxable year. KS WebFile. KS WebFile is a FREE online application for filing Kansas Individual Income tax returns. Refunds can be deposited directly into your bank account. For a balance due, payment methods are electronic check or credit card (MasterCard, Discover or American Express). The difference in the Federal standard deduction for head of household over that for a single taxpayer is $6000($18,000- $12,000 = $6,000).
